I am starting to think about getting a newer Mac than my current G3 Beige MiniTower OS 9 (dual HD, CD, ZIP, SCSI Scanner, LaserWriter Pro 630, Cannon s520 InkJet)

Of course I could buy one of the new models, an eMac, an iMac, or a G5 but that could be a lot of cash and require a lot of s/w upgrades (mine are of the OS8 vintage). A used iMac or G4 seems more appropriate.

Can some one tell me which are the latest models that will run OS9 applications (besides Panther) and all that older s/w? (to save or defer the cost of s/w upgrades)?

Can you tell me the latest models that can take a SCSI card (so I can keep some of my old peripherals running)?

All but the last models of G4 towers. In fact IIRC, Apple is now shipping the last G4 tower with OS 9 capability.
